Unfortunately not. Well, at least not exactly. What you can do is perform a
Voice Initialize from a a collection of templates.

o Enter 130 into the keypad as you would select a patch.
o Select Yes
o Choose an initial voice setting:

1. Normal (whatever that means)
2. Bass
3. Brass
4. Strings
5. E.Piano
6. Organ
7. Sync mono
8. PWM

o Tweak your new patch
o Be sure to save your new patch using the Store function


See Page 97 in the manual for full details, and please post back if you're
stuck.
